Zaxxon's Motherbase 2000 is a game exclusive to the Sega 32X. In Japan it was released as Parasquad, but in North America it was renamed to form a connection with Sega's past hit Zaxxon and its direct sequels.

Instead of controlling both sideways and vertical movement there is instead a "jump" button that temporarily makes the ship fly higher. This move can also be used on supply ships and some enemies to earn upgrades. The enemies are all drawn with polygons, some taking up the whole screen, but they are untextured and cause some slowdown. There are also holes in the levels that the ship will fall into if flown over.
